BUENOS AIRES, May 29 (Xinhua) -- The number of dengue cases in Argentina
reached 25,833, Argentine Health Ministry said on Friday.
Despite 3,107 more people have been infected with the disease since the
last report was released on April 30, Argentine authorities said the dengue
epidemic is being controlled.
From February to April, the country has seen a large number of mosquitoes
of all kinds, including the Aedes aegypti, which is a carrier of dengue.
The northern province of Chaco, where 10,796 cases have been registered, is
the worst hit area in the country. While in Catamarca, another northern
province, 8,703 cases have been registered.
